[发明专利]一种云端分布式检测方法、系统及相关装置在审
申请号: | 201810223459.6 | 申请日: | 2018-03-19 |
公开(公告)号: | CN108429754A | 公开(公告)日: | 2018-08-21 |
发明(设计)人: | 邓华光 | 申请(专利权)人: | 深信服科技股份有限公司 |
主分类号: | H04L29/06 | 分类号: | H04L29/06;H04L29/08 |
代理公司: | 深圳市深佳知识产权代理事务所(普通合伙) 44285 | 代理人: | 王仲凯 |
地址: | 518055 广东省深圳市南*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 待检测文件 计算组件 云端 检测 分布式检测 相关装置 预置 分布式检测系统 文件检测请求 用户身份标识 接收客户端 病毒文件 基本信息 内存资源 任务类型 任务配置 容器技术 应用程序 用户主机 准确率 封装 判定 节约 分配 部署 统计 | ||
本发明实施例提供了一种云端分布式检测方法、系统及相关装置,节约了用户主机cpu及内存资源,提高了检测的准确率。本发明实施例方法包括:接收客户端提交的文件检测请求,请求中包含至少一个待检测文件及用户身份标识ID;根据用户ID确定待检测文件的任务类型,并将每一个待检测文件及其基本信息封装为预置类型的计算任务;为每种类型的计算任务配置至少两种类型的计算组件进行检测计算,并为每一种类型的计算组件的检测计算结果分配对应的评分,每一个计算组件均为采用Docker容器技术部署在云端分布式检测系统中的应用程序;统计每一个待检测文件对应的所有检测计算结果的总评分,若总评分高于预置阀值,则判定对应的待检测文件为病毒文件。
技术领域
本发明涉及信息安全技术领域,尤其涉及一种云端分布式检测方法、系统及相关装置。
背景技术
随着大数据时代的来临,终端数据的安全检测的任务也越来越繁重,目前终端文件病毒查杀基于本地病毒库、特征库来进行查杀。
现有方案中,基于本地病毒库、特征库来进行查杀存在如下问题,本地病毒库,特征库等体量非常大,占用过多的用户存储空间,在本地采用病毒库,特征库等杀毒检测文件时会耗费主机的大量cpu,内存等资源,造成卡顿等不良的用户体验。其次,现有的检测方案往往是基于单一维度判断文件是否为病毒文件,存在错误检测的风险。
有鉴于此,有必要提供一种新的云端分布式检测方法。
发明内容
本发明实施例提供了一种云端分布式检测方法、系统及相关装置,基于云端实现终端文件病毒查杀,节约本地系统资源,提高了检测的准确率。
本发明实施例第一方面提供了一种云端分布式检测方法,运用于云端分布式检测系统,其特征在于,包括:
接收客户端提交的文件检测请求,所述请求中包含至少一个待检测文件及用户身份标识ID;
根据所述用户ID确定待检测文件的任务类型,并将每一个待检测文件及其基本信息封装为预置类型的计算任务;
为每种类型的计算任务配置至少两种类型的计算组件进行检测计算,并为每一种类型的计算组件的检测计算结果分配对应的评分,每一个计算组件均为采用Docker容器技术部署在所述云端分布式检测系统中的应用程序;
统计每一个待检测文件对应的所有检测计算结果的总评分,若所述总评分高于预置阀值,则判定对应的待检测文件为病毒文件。
可选的,作为一种可能的实施方式,在所述为每种类型的计算任务配置至少两种类型的计算组件之前,还包括:
根据计算任务的类型将计算任务分类存储在任务队列中,所述任务队列为Kafka分布式发布订阅消息系统组件。
可选的,作为一种可能的实施方式,所述为每种类型的计算任务配置至少两种类型的计算组件,包括:
根据所述任务队列中的计算任务的数量、任务类型及任务紧急程度确定资源需求,所述资源需求为在限定时间内完成对应的计算任务所需的计算组件的类型及数量;
统计所述云端分布式检测系统中当前计算资源;
若所述计算资源满足所述资源需求,则将所述任务队列中的计算任务分发到对应类型的计算组件中进行检测计算;
若所述计算资源不满足所述资源需求,则采用镜像的方式部署部分计算组件至租借的服务器中,以完成对应的计算任务的检测计算,或,将所述任务队列中的计算任务分为多阶段进行检测。
可选的,作为一种可能的实施方式,该方法还包括:
将所述待检测文件对应的检测结果进行分布式存储;
根据客户端的查询请求,向对应的客户端反馈所述待检测文件对应的检测结果。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于深信服科技股份有限公司,未经深信服科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810223459.6/2.html,转载请声明来源钻瓜专利网。